Value Place Secures $100m Capital Investment

The investment allows Value Place to add at least 50 new company locations while continuing to expand its current franchise base.  
By HNN Newswire
January 23, 2013 | 6:03 P.M.

WICHITA, Kansas—Value Place, a U.S. franchisor, developer, operator and owner, announced Tuesday that it has secured a $100 million capital investment from Lindsay Goldberg LLC, a private equity firm with $10 billion of total capital under management.

The transaction, along with planned successive investments, equips Value Place with the necessary capital to continue and accelerate its growth plan. The current and follow on investments will be used to add at least 50 new company locations while continuing to expand its current franchise base. Plans also include the roll out of “Value Place 2.0” upgrades across the company owned locations. The Value Place executive team finalized the transaction on Dec. 27th, 2012. The existing senior management team led by Dan Weber, CEO and Kyle Rogg, President and COO will remain intact. Founder and visionary Jack DeBoer will continue to serve as chairman and ensure the Brand delivers on its core values: affordable, clean, safe, simple and flexible.

Company Continues on Course of Growth and Enhancement
News of the private equity investment came as Value Place celebrated the opening of its 181st unit, a property located in Odessa, TX. New locations in College Station, TX, Dickinson, ND and Manassas, VA will open later this year. Value Place’s financial strength and stability, growth rate and system size helped achieve a substantial jump in the recently published Franchise 500 by Entrepreneur, soaring to number 210 from its position at number 493 in 2012.
